Clipt is a brand new utility launched by the OneLabs group at OnePlus. The app allows clipboard-like performance throughout a number of units and means that you can ship textual content, photographs, and information between your telephones, tablets, and laptops. With Clipt, customers can copy a textual content from their cellphone and pate it onto their pc seamlessly. They now not must search for a workaround to ship textual content from their cellular to their laptop computer. Clipt makes use of your Google Drive account to switch textual content, photographs, and information throughout units so long as customers login with the identical Google account on their units.
Clipt is offered as an Android app on the Google Play store for smartphones and tablets and as a Chrome extension for Windows and Mac customers. OnePlus says that it’s going to launch the app for iOS customers quickly. The Clipt app and Chrome extension creates a hyperlink between your units to seamlessly join your clipboard. Once put in you’ll be able to copy on one gadget and paste on one other or use it to ship information backwards and forwards simply between as many units as you want.
The new textual content, picture, and file sharing app seems to eradicate the necessity to electronic mail your self a picture, or message your self on a chat app simply to get one thing from one gadget to a different. You additionally will not must search for a workaround to the 25MB restrict on electronic mail shoppers, and be capable to ship massive information throughout units. As talked about, Clipt makes use of your individual Google Drive to switch the information and the one prerequisite is to sign up to the units you wish to switch information between utilizing the identical Google account.
OnePlus stresses that the information shared with Clipt is safe. “In the permissions, you’ll see we request the read and write of your Google storage, but Clipt can only download the files it creates as it’s siloed,” the corporate explains in a blog post. “In the app or extension we keep the last 10 items available to you, but after that it auto deletes so it won’t fill up your storage.”
